Adam Gase was not the only member of the Jets organization to get a vote of confidence from CEO and chairman Christopher Johnson on Wednesday.
Johnson also said he would like to see safety Jamal Adams remain a Jet “forever” just two weeks after the team had trade discussions about him.
“Jamal is a fantastic player. We saw that this Sunday,” Johnson said. “He’s an extraordinary player. He’s the kind of player you can build around, you should build around given the chance. He’s absolutely amazing. I would love to have him on the team for the rest of his career.
